Jogging around Grad Jastrebarsko offers diverse natural landscapes, making it an excellent destination for running. The region is characterized by the prominent Plešivica Mountain ridge, known for its vineyards and views, and bordered by the Žumberak Mountains and Nature Park, which features dense woodlands and varied terrain. Lush forests, gentle winegrowing hills, and the tranquil Reka Creek contribute to the area's natural charm, providing a scenic backdrop for various running routes.

Oštrc (752 m) is the highest peak of the middle ridge of the Samobor Mountains. It is characterized by a pyramidal shape with steep slopes. From the top there is an open view in all directions.

Yes, Grad Jastrebarsko offers several moderate routes. For a scenic and relatively flat option, consider the Dvorac Erdödy loop from Jastrebarsko, which is 8 km long with minimal elevation gain. Another moderate choice is the Lepa glavica loop from Pavlovčani, a 6.5 km trail through varied landscapes.
The region is rich in natural beauty. You can run through lush forests, gentle winegrowing hills, and along the tranquil Reka Creek. Notable features include the prominent Plešivica Mountain ridge with its vineyards, and the wider Žumberak Mountains and Nature Park. Many routes offer stunning views, especially from higher elevations like those found on Plešivica.
Absolutely. The Plešivica Mountain region, which borders Jastrebarsko, is known for its expansive views. While running, you might catch glimpses of vineyards and scattered villages. For specific viewpoints, consider routes that ascend towards peaks like Japetić or Stražnik, which offer breathtaking panoramas. The Japetić Observation Tower and Plešivica Summit and Lookout Tower are popular spots for stunning vistas.
For experienced runners, Grad Jastrebarsko provides several challenging long-distance options. The Running loop from Jastrebarsko is a difficult 22.4 km path through diverse terrain. Another demanding route is the View of Rude from Cerje loop from Samobor, which spans over 26 km with significant elevation changes.
Yes, many of the running routes in the area are circular,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the Rancerje – Stražnik loop from Prekrižje Plešivičko, the Lepa glavica loop from Pavlovčani, and the Dvorac Erdödy loop from Jastrebarsko.
The region's diverse landscapes make it suitable for running in various seasons.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and vibrant scenery, with blooming wildflowers or colorful foliage. Summer is also popular, especially in the cooler forest areas or during early mornings/late evenings. Winter running is possible, but some trails might be more challenging due to snow or ice, particularly at higher elevations.
Yes, several routes pass by or near interesting attractions. The Dvorac Erdödy loop takes you through the beautiful Erdödy Castle Park, a protected landscape monument. The region is also home to the Sopotnjak Waterfall and the Stražnik Peak, which can be incorporated into longer runs.
While many routes offer varied terrain, some of the moderate, shorter loops with less elevation gain can be suitable for families who enjoy active outings. The trails around Erdödy Castle Park, for instance, provide a pleasant and accessible environment. Always check the route's difficulty and length to ensure it matches your family's fitness level.
Runners frequently praise the diverse natural landscapes, from dense forests and tranquil creeks to picturesque vineyards and mountain views. The well-maintained trails and the peaceful atmosphere of the Žumberak Mountains and Plešivica region are often highlighted as key attractions for an enjoyable running experience.
To find less crowded spots, consider exploring trails deeper within the Žumberak Nature Park or on the slopes of Plešivica Mountain, away from the immediate vicinity of Jastrebarsko town center. Early mornings or weekdays are generally the best times to experience more solitude on any trail.
